Farm Crawl Locations

Fitkin Popcorn 2FITKIN Popcorn, 5400 Ford Road, Cedar Falls

Learn all about one of America’s favorite snacks, popcorn! FITKIN Popcorn, the producers of FIT-POP, is part of a 4th generation family farm located in northeast Iowa. See how popcorn grows, how it’s stored and view the cleaning process. Try some delicious popcorn samples and buy some to bring home for snacking. Visitors will also learn about growing tomatoes in a high tunnel. A high tunnel (Seasonal Tunnel System for Crops) is a plastic covered structure that allows growers to increase production of certain crops.

Beck Barn 1Beck’s Orchard, 14124 Beck Road, Buckingham

Take an orchard tour and operate the cider press. Learn about in-season varieties and the orchard manager’s collection of antique varieties including Wolf River, Sheep’s nose, Hawkeye and Gravenstein. Enjoy tasting apple samples and buy some apples to take home with you! Get to know Beck’s goats and learn more about how their special breed is gaining popularity as a lean, tasty, nutrient dense source of protein. The Beck’s beautiful barn was moved to the farm and re-imagined for orchard business in 2015. There will be brief barn talks about the transformation on the hour

Big Rock Bison 3Big Rock Bison, 13906 Kimball Ave, Bucking Ham

Visit the Yuska family farm to learn more about our national mammal, the American bison! Discover the history of bison in the United States and the future of bison production with a short presentation given by farm owners at the beginning of each hour. Enjoy educational hands-on activities and see these great animals in person! When visiting Big Rock Bison, please keep your hands out of the enclosure for your safety and for the safety of the bison!
